RMBT and the Architecture of Open Sponsorship Finance
Traditional sponsorship structures depend on fragmented banking systems and delayed reconciliations. Payments can take weeks to settle, and tracking the movement of funds across multiple currencies often leads to opacity and inefficiency. The rise of Web3 sponsorships introduces programmable contracts, fan engagement tokens, and real-time data tracking but these innovations require a trusted financial base. RMBT’s Open Ledger Mode provides exactly that.
The system records every sponsorship transaction on-chain, where data such as contract terms, payment milestones, and fund utilization can be verified instantly. Smart contracts ensure that payments are automatically triggered once pre-agreed marketing or performance conditions are fulfilled. A global sponsor, for example, can release funds to a European football club after verified digital campaign engagement metrics are achieved, all through automated, RMBT-based settlements.
Unlike private or semi-permissioned blockchain systems, RMBT’s Open Ledger Mode introduces controlled transparency a structure where visibility is extended to relevant stakeholders but remains compliant with the EU’s MiCA (Markets in Crypto-Assets) regulation. Each transaction follows regulatory protocols embedded into the blockchain’s core logic, combining innovation with oversight.

RMBT and Tokenized Partnership Models
The tokenization of sponsorship agreements marks one of the most significant shifts in modern sports finance. With RMBT’s Open Ledger Mode, these agreements can be represented as digital tokens, each linked to contract-specific conditions and performance outcomes.
For example, a sponsor could hold digital tokens representing advertising rights or performance-linked payouts, automatically redeemable based on verified results. These tokens are backed by RMBT’s tokenized reserves, ensuring that every obligation is matched by actual liquidity on the blockchain. This mechanism provides sponsors with both flexibility and financial security, while enabling clubs to manage obligations in a fully auditable environment.
RMBT’s compliance architecture further strengthens this model. Smart contracts can be integrated with data oracles that verify match performance metrics, media exposure rates, or audience engagement figures. Once conditions are validated, the system executes payments automatically, ensuring accuracy and reducing administrative overhead.
By combining tokenization with open-ledger verification, RMBT is transforming sponsorships into programmable financial ecosystems that reward accountability and innovation simultaneously.
